4.9.5.

 

Deadband setting 

 

Deadband  means  maximum  allowable  tolerance  of  the  actuator  stop  position  according  to 
command signal.  

 

It is also minimum variation value of command signal to operate the actuator.  

 

 

Adjustable setting range : (16 steps available)  

 

Step 0~4 : increase 0.1% increment per step  

(0.3 ~ 0.7 % for PCU-EB-V1.5D ac) 

(0.4 ~ 0.8 % for PCU-DC-V2.1C dc) 

 

Step 5~9 : increase 0.2% increment per step (1.0% ~ 1.8%) 

 

Step A~F : increase 0.5% increment per step (5.0% ~ 7.5%) 

 

Initial setting is “4” 

 

If  the  setting  value  is  too  low,  the  actuator  may  not  be  found  the  target  point  and  it  may  be 
repeatedly  operated  in  forward  or  reverse  direction.  This  is  called  “Hunting”  and  the  user  must 
appropriately adjust the deadband to avoid from the hunting.  

 

Continuous  hunting  causes  a  failure  of  the  actuator  parts  such  as  motor,  PCU  board, 
potentiometer and etc.  

4.9.6.

 

Deadtime setting 

 

 

This is necessary to apply the command signal.  

 

It is the minimum time for maintaining the state of the input signal satisfying the deadband.  

 

Actuator  only  accepts  input  signal  satisfying  the  setting  value  of  the  deadtime  as  normal  and 
operates.  It  is  for  preventing  from  abnormal  operation  of  the  actuator  by  external  disturbance 
such as noise.  

 

Adjustable setting range : 0.2~7.5 sec (16 steps available)  

 

Step 0 

 

: 0.2 sec (minimum value) 

 

Step 1~4  : increase 0.25 sec increment per step (0.25~1 sec) 

 

Step 5~F  : increase 0.50 sec increment per step (2.5~7.5 sec) 

 

Initial setting is “4”
